Red Wine Mushroom Sauce

Luxurious Red Wine Mushroom Sauce for Any Meat Lover

This Red Wine Mushroom Sauce elevates any meat dish into a gourmet experience with rich flavors that are simple to prepare.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Sauces
Cuisine: French
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Sauce Base
  • 1 cup Red Wine Use a dry wine like Cabernet Sauvignon.
  • 1 cup Beef Broth Vegetable broth can be used for a lighter version.
  • 2 tablespoons Worcestershire Sauce
For the Vegetables
  • 3 tablespoons Shallots Finely chopped.
  • 8 ounces Baby Bella Mushrooms Sliced.
  • 2 cloves Garlic Cloves Minced.
  • 2 teaspoons Fresh Thyme Can substitute with rosemary or parsley.
For Thickening and Richness
  • 2 tablespoons Flour For gluten-free, use cornstarch mixed with water.
  • 2 tablespoons Butter Salted butter enhances flavor.

Equipment

  • large sauté pan

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Silky Red Wine Mushroom Sauce
  1. In a large sauté pan, melt 2 ounces of butter over medium-high heat until bubbling and frothy, about 1 to 2 minutes.
  2. Add sliced baby Bella mushrooms to the pan and cook for 5 to 7 minutes without stirring until golden brown. Flip and cook for another 3 to 5 minutes until browned on both sides.
  3. Add remaining butter to the pan. Once melted, add finely chopped shallots and minced garlic. Sauté for 3 to 4 minutes until shallots are soft and translucent.
  4. Pour in red wine, beef broth, and Worcestershire sauce. Stir and bring to a gentle boil. Let reduce for about 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  5. Mix flour with beef broth to create a slurry, then add to the sauce while stirring continuously until thickened, about 3 to 5 minutes.
  6. Check seasoning and adjust if needed. Return sautéed mushrooms to the sauce and keep warm on low heat until ready to serve.
